Red River was not able to break out of their rough patch on Wednesday as the team picked up their third straight loss. They fell 12-8 to Elizabeth.
Jayden Stewart was cooking despite his team's loss, going 2-for-3 with one triple, two RBI, and one run. That triple was his first of the season.
Red River's defeat dropped their record down to 13-7-1. As for Elizabeth, their win bumped their record up to 15-6.
Both squads are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Red River will welcome Winnfield at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day. Winnfield is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 7.1 runs per game this season. As for Elizabeth, they will face off against Hackberry at 4:00 p.m. on Thursday. Elizabeth's pitching crew has only allowed 3.9 runs per game this season, so Hackberry's hitters will have their work cut out for them.
